Lifecore (LFCR) market outlook | growth forecasts and investor confidence remain in focus. Lifecore Biomedical Inc. (LFCR) is trading at $5.01, up 0.91% in the session. The stock is positioned just below its near-term resistance level of $5.26, while support is established at $4.76. The price action suggests a narrowing range as traders assess the next directional move.

From a technical perspective, LFCR is consolidating within a defined range between support at $4.76 and resistance at $5.26. The current price of $5.01 sits almost exactly in the middle of that range, but the stock’s upward trajectory this session brings it closer to the upper boundary. Price action over the past several weeks has formed a series of higher lows, indicating that buying pressure is gradually building. The stock is approaching its 50-day moving average, which could act as a dynamic resistance point.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I), are likely in the neutral to slightly bullish zone—potentially in the mid-50s—suggesting room for further upside before reaching overbought conditions. The MACD may be nearing a bullish crossover as the shorter-term moving average rises toward the longer-term average. Volume patterns remain moderate, which could limit the strength of any breakout attempt. If LFCR can clear the $5.26 resistance on above-average volume, it may signal a trend reversal. Conversely, failure to break through could result in a retest of support near $4.76 or even lower levels around $4.50. The symmetrical nature of the range suggests that a breakout move, if it materializes, could lead to a swift move toward the next resistance in the $5.50–$5.75 area.
